Recently, a type of GUT models with an extra dimension in AdS space can successfully solve the doublet-triplet problem, maintain proton stability, and allow the colored Higgs bosons and colored Higgsinos in the TeV mass region. We study the hadronic production and detection of these TeV colored Higgsinos and Higgs bosons. If the colored Higgsino is lighter than the colored Higgs boson, the colored Higgs boson will decay into a colored Higgsino and a gluino or a gravitino, and vice versa. The signatures would be stable massive charged particles with jets or missing energies.
